NEW MILFORD  – Temple Sholom will be welcoming a new rabbi in July.

Rabbi Ari Rosenberg was elected by the temple congregation Sunday to fill the role of its retired rabbi Norman Koch. Since Koch’s retirement last July, interim-rabbi Scott Saulson has led the Temple Sholom congregation.

Rosenberg will be coming to New Milford from his present position as rabbi at Temple Sha’arey Shalom in Springfield, N.J. Coming to New Milford is a return to his home state of Connecticut, where he grew up in Waterford, the son of Rabbi Aron Rosenberg.

“The Rabbi Search Committee found Rabbi Rosenberg to be a consensus builder who is active in his present community,” said Temple Sholom President Howard Lapidus. “The congregation overwhelmingly voted for him.”

Rabbi Rosenberg was ordained at the Hebrew Union College- Jewish Institute of Religion in May 2008. He received his Bachelors degree from Rutgers University in 1996. He has two children, Ezra and Mayaan.
